Sports section:
Since I use the clock, especially with the Endomondo Sportapp in conjunction with a Bluetooth heart rate belt from Polar, here my sport test comes this:
First I had the problem that I could never find the Endomondoapp. After I dug myself for hours through Internet forums, I found the solution: You have to reinstall the app, then Endomondo is automatically displayed on the clock.
The app is beautiful and well laid out, what was important for me: The pulse appears on the clock!
Endomondo has 3 screens, on the 1st, the distance traveled and time is displayed on the 2nd lap time or speed and on the 3rd of the pulse.
The training can be started by a tip and pause or stopped. Up between the screens are replaced by wipe.
Since the numbers are quite large, the values can be read even in bright sunlight.
Unfortunately, the screen turns off each time after a few seconds (to save power)
which is why you always have to activate the display while running.
Because the display is quite small, the control is in run-especially if you schwitzt- quite heavy and you often unintentionally pauses the workout. Very annoying!
Much worse that the sleeve while running, the clock enable and training stop and you have to start again with a new workout as distance again 0km- what is really annoying.
The solution: umkrämpeln sleeves. Unfortunately in the winter certainly no solution. I hope Endomondo is this considered somewhat and the problem is fixed with the next update.
